Annual Recall Is the Profit Center of Every Optometry Practice

Optometry practices generate a significant portion

of revenue from annual comprehensive exams and associated product sales (glasses, contacts). When patients skip their annual exam, the practice loses not just the exam fee but the optical sales that follow. A portal with reliable recall reminders protects this revenue stream and keeps patients in the annual cycle.

Family scheduling represents a massive growth

opportunity in optometry. When one family member switches to your practice and can easily add the rest of the household, you multiply patient count with minimal acquisition cost. A portal that facilitates family management turns individual patients into household accounts worth 3-5x the revenue.

Why Your Optometry Practice Needs a Client Portal

Optometry's annual visit cycle makes it

easy for patients to procrastinate scheduling. Unlike dental cleanings that most people know they need twice a year, eye exams often get delayed until discomfort forces action. A portal with proactive reminders and frictionless booking recaptures these lapsed patients before they find another provider.

Prescription access

another reason patients contact your office. Whether they're ordering glasses online or visiting a different provider, patients frequently call to confirm their prescription. A portal that makes prescriptions available on demand eliminates these calls and provides a value-add that keeps patients connected to your practice.

Common Mistakes to Avoid

Only reminding patients about annual exams via postcard or single email

Use multi-channel portal reminders (email + SMS) with escalating frequency as the due date approaches

Not providing prescription history access in the patient portal

Display current and past prescriptions so patients can reference them without calling the office

Missing the opportunity to capture family members through the portal

Offer family account features that let existing patients add household members for easy scheduling
